On tap at the Brewpub. Perhaps this year’s batch is better than last year’s, because I thought it was quite good. Simple, amber color with fast-fading white head. Malty, a little nutty, a little spicy, a little fruity smell and taste. Nothing like exceptional, but goes down easy and smooth. Not bad.

UPDATED: JAN 26, 2009 On tap at Brewpub.
Appearance: light amber with creamy white top. 3+
Aroma: Light, slightly plane malty nose, slight nutty character. 6-.
Flavour/Palate: medium, smooth bodied. Malty bottom with strong hazelnut feel. Woody with bitter green finish. Quiet good Okto. Stylistically solid sample.

9/24/08 - Draft Sample at Brewpub. Pours amber/orange with white head and decent lacing. Malty nose. Taste is caramel and mild chocolate and even mild roast. Creamy mouth feel, mild hop characterand grassy notes. Crisp ending

On tap. Golden body, small white head, hoppy nose for the style. While this was a reasonably pleasant brew (unlike some of their others, which are often syrupy and flat), it doesn't fit the style very well; not particularly malty or toasty.
